Wairarapa Balloon Festival Family Carnival this Saturday 🎈

Denver Grenell from Destination Wairarapa

The Wairarapa Balloon Festival Family Carnival takes flight at Solway Showgrounds this Saturday. Don’t miss it! 🙌 It’s the best value event for families this Easter. 🐣🌷

🎟️ Tickets include five hours of action-packed entertainment for the whole family—fun for the young and the young at heart! 💖 Limited ticket sales will be available on the day, but they encourage you to purchase in advance to avoid disappointment.

The forecast for the Family Carnival on Saturday is looking good. The weather for the morning ascensions, which start this Thursday, is a bit mixed. ☁️ You can stay updated via the Wairarapa Balloon Festival socials.

Please note: In the unlikely event they have to cancel the Family Carnival, any pre-purchased tickets will be refunded back to the ticket holder, minus any ticketing fees. 💸

Poll: Should the government levy industries that contribute to financial hardship?

The Team from Neighbourly.co.nz

As reported in the Post, there’s a $30 million funding gap in financial mentoring. This has led to services closing and mentors stepping in unpaid just to keep helping people in need 🪙💰🪙

One proposed solution? Small levies on industries that profit from financial hardship — like banks, casinos, and similar companies.
